Can I make Big Back Sauce ahead of time?
Yes. Mix the sauce components and refrigerate in an airtight container for up to 5 days. Stir well before serving; add fresh parsley and bacon just before use for best texture.
Is Big Back Sauce thick or runny?
The sour cream base makes it creamy and spreadable, not watery. Adjust thickness by adding more sour cream or lemon juice to taste.
What's the difference between this and regular ranch?
Big Back Sauce layers cowboy butter, marry me steak sauce, fresh herbs, parmesan, and bacon into a more complex, savory profile than standard ranch.
Can I use this sauce for meal prep?
Store cooked bacon separately and mix into the sauce just before serving to maintain crispness. The herb and sour cream base holds for 4–5 days refrigerated.
What's the best way to serve Big Back Sauce?
Use as a warm or room-temperature dipping sauce for grilled meats, or dollop on top of steak, burgers, and wings. Serve fresh from the refrigerator or gently warmed.
